- Docs Home
- About TiDB Cloud
- Get Started
- Develop Applications
- Overview
- Quick Start
- Connect to TiDB Cloud
- GUI Database Tools
- Choose Driver or ORM
- BI
- Java
- Go
- Python
- Node.js
- Ruby
- WordPress
- Serverless Driver (Beta)
- Third-Party Support
- Development Reference
- Design Database Schema
- Write Data
- Read Data
- Transaction
- Optimize
- Troubleshoot
- Development Guidelines
- Bookshop Example Application
- Manage Cluster
- Plan Your Cluster
- Manage TiDB Serverless Clusters
- Create a TiDB Serverless Cluster
- Connect to Your TiDB Serverless Cluster
- Branch (Beta)
- Manage Spending Limit
- Back Up and Restore TiDB Serverless Data
- Export Data from TiDB Serverless
- Manage TiDB Dedicated Clusters
- Create a TiDB Dedicated Cluster
- Connect to Your TiDB Dedicated Cluster
- Scale a TiDB Dedicated Cluster
- Back Up and Restore TiDB Dedicated Data
- Pause or Resume a TiDB Dedicated Cluster
- Configure Maintenance Window
- Use an HTAP Cluster with TiFlash
- Monitor and Alert
- Tune Performance
- Overview
- Analyze Performance
- SQL Tuning
- Overview
- Understanding the Query Execution Plan
- SQL Optimization Process
- Overview
- Logic Optimization
- Physical Optimization
- Prepared Execution Plan Cache
- Non-Prepared Execution Plan Cache
- Control Execution Plans
- TiKV Follower Read
- Coprocessor Cache
- Garbage Collection (GC)
- Tune TiFlash Performance
- Upgrade a TiDB Cluster
- Delete a TiDB Cluster
- Migrate or Import Data
- Overview
- Migrate Data into TiDB Cloud
- Migrate Existing and Incremental Data Using Data Migration
- Migrate Incremental Data Using Data Migration
- Migrate and Merge MySQL Shards of Large Datasets
- Migrate from On-Premises TiDB to TiDB Cloud
- Migrate from MySQL-Compatible Databases Using AWS DMS
- Migrate from Amazon RDS for Oracle Using AWS DMS
- Import Data into TiDB Cloud
- Reference
- Explore Data
- Vector Search (Beta)
- Overview
- Get Started
- Integrations
- Overview
- AI Frameworks
- Embedding Models/Services
- ORM Libraries
- Reference
- Improve Performance
- Limitations
- Changelogs
- Data Service (Beta)
- Stream Data
- Disaster Recovery
- Security
- Identity Access Control
- Network Access Control
- Data Access Control
- Database Access Control
- Audit Management
- Billing
- Managed Service Provider Program
- API
- API Overview
- API Reference
- v1beta1
- v1beta
- Integrations
- Reference
- TiDB Cluster Architecture
- TiDB Dedicated Limitations and Quotas
- TiDB Serverless Limitations
- Limited SQL Features on TiDB Cloud
- TiDB Limitations
- TiDB Distributed eXecution Framework (DXF)
- Benchmarks
- SQL
- Explore SQL with TiDB
- SQL Language Structure and Syntax
- SQL Statements
- Overview
ADMINADMIN CANCEL DDLADMIN CHECKSUM TABLEADMIN CHECK [TABLE|INDEX]ADMIN CLEANUP INDEXADMIN PAUSE DDLADMIN RECOVER INDEXADMIN RESUME DDLADMIN SHOW DDL [JOBS|JOB QUERIES]ALTER DATABASEALTER INSTANCEALTER PLACEMENT POLICYALTER RANGEALTER RESOURCE GROUPALTER SEQUENCEALTER TABLEALTER USERANALYZE TABLEBACKUPBATCHBEGINCANCEL IMPORT JOBCOMMITCREATE [GLOBAL|SESSION] BINDINGCREATE DATABASECREATE INDEXCREATE PLACEMENT POLICYCREATE RESOURCE GROUPCREATE ROLECREATE SEQUENCECREATE TABLE LIKECREATE TABLECREATE USERCREATE VIEWDEALLOCATEDELETEDESCDESCRIBEDODROP [GLOBAL|SESSION] BINDINGDROP DATABASEDROP INDEXDROP PLACEMENT POLICYDROP RESOURCE GROUPDROP ROLEDROP SEQUENCEDROP STATSDROP TABLEDROP USERDROP VIEWEXECUTEEXPLAIN ANALYZEEXPLAINFLASHBACK CLUSTERFLASHBACK DATABASEFLASHBACK TABLEFLUSH PRIVILEGESFLUSH STATUSFLUSH TABLESGRANT <privileges>GRANT <role>IMPORT INTOINSERTKILL [TIDB]LOAD DATALOAD STATSLOCK STATSLOCK TABLESandUNLOCK TABLESPREPAREQUERY WATCHRECOVER TABLERENAME TABLERENAME USERREPLACERESTOREREVOKE <privileges>REVOKE <role>ROLLBACKSAVEPOINTSELECTSET DEFAULT ROLESET [NAMES|CHARACTER SET]SET PASSWORDSET RESOURCE GROUPSET ROLESET TRANSACTIONSET [GLOBAL|SESSION] <variable>SHOW ANALYZE STATUSSHOW [BACKUPS|RESTORES]SHOW [GLOBAL|SESSION] BINDINGSSHOW BUILTINSSHOW CHARACTER SETSHOW COLLATIONSHOW COLUMN_STATS_USAGESHOW COLUMNS FROMSHOW CREATE DATABASESHOW CREATE PLACEMENT POLICYSHOW CREATE RESOURCE GROUPSHOW CREATE SEQUENCESHOW CREATE TABLESHOW CREATE USERSHOW DATABASESSHOW ENGINESSHOW ERRORSSHOW FIELDS FROMSHOW GRANTSSHOW IMPORT JOBSHOW INDEXES [FROM|IN]SHOW MASTER STATUSSHOW PLACEMENTSHOW PLACEMENT FORSHOW PLACEMENT LABELSSHOW PLUGINSSHOW PRIVILEGESSHOW PROCESSLISTSHOW PROFILESSHOW SCHEMASSHOW STATS_BUCKETSSHOW STATS_HEALTHYSHOW STATS_HISTOGRAMSSHOW STATS_LOCKEDSHOW STATS_METASHOW STATS_TOPNSHOW STATUSSHOW TABLE NEXT_ROW_IDSHOW TABLE REGIONSSHOW TABLE STATUSSHOW TABLESSHOW [GLOBAL|SESSION] VARIABLESSHOW WARNINGSSPLIT REGIONSTART TRANSACTIONTABLETRACETRUNCATEUNLOCK STATSUPDATEUSEWITH
- Data Types
- Functions and Operators
- Overview
- Type Conversion in Expression Evaluation
- Operators
- Control Flow Functions
- String Functions
- Numeric Functions and Operators
- Date and Time Functions
- Bit Functions and Operators
- Cast Functions and Operators
- Encryption and Compression Functions
- Locking Functions
- Information Functions
- JSON Functions
- Aggregate (GROUP BY) Functions
- GROUP BY Modifiers
- Window Functions
- Miscellaneous Functions
- Precision Math
- Set Operations
- Sequence Functions
- List of Expressions for Pushdown
- TiDB Specific Functions
- Clustered Indexes
- Constraints
- Generated Columns
- SQL Mode
- Table Attributes
- Transactions
- Views
- Partitioning
- Temporary Tables
- Cached Tables
- FOREIGN KEY Constraints
- Character Set and Collation
- Read Historical Data
- Placement Rules in SQL
- System Tables
mysqlSchema- INFORMATION_SCHEMA
- Overview
ANALYZE_STATUSCHECK_CONSTRAINTSCLIENT_ERRORS_SUMMARY_BY_HOSTCLIENT_ERRORS_SUMMARY_BY_USERCLIENT_ERRORS_SUMMARY_GLOBALCHARACTER_SETSCLUSTER_INFOCOLLATIONSCOLLATION_CHARACTER_SET_APPLICABILITYCOLUMNSDATA_LOCK_WAITSDDL_JOBSDEADLOCKSENGINESKEYWORDSKEY_COLUMN_USAGEMEMORY_USAGEMEMORY_USAGE_OPS_HISTORYPARTITIONSPLACEMENT_POLICIESPROCESSLISTREFERENTIAL_CONSTRAINTSRESOURCE_GROUPSRUNAWAY_WATCHESSCHEMATASEQUENCESSESSION_VARIABLESSLOW_QUERYSTATISTICSTABLESTABLE_CONSTRAINTSTABLE_STORAGE_STATSTIDB_HOT_REGIONS_HISTORYTIDB_INDEXESTIDB_INDEX_USAGETIDB_SERVERS_INFOTIDB_TRXTIFLASH_REPLICATIFLASH_SEGMENTSTIFLASH_TABLESTIKV_REGION_PEERSTIKV_REGION_STATUSTIKV_STORE_STATUSUSER_ATTRIBUTESUSER_PRIVILEGESVARIABLES_INFOVIEWS
- PERFORMANCE_SCHEMA
- SYS
- Metadata Lock
- Use UUIDs
- TiDB Accelerated Table Creation
- System Variables
- Server Status Variables
- Storage Engines
- TiKV
- TiFlash
- CLI
- Overview
- auth
- serverless
- ai
- completion
- config
- project
- update
- help
- Table Filter
- Resource Control
- URI Formats of External Storage Services
- DDL Execution Principles and Best Practices
- Troubleshoot Inconsistency Between Data and Indexes
- Support
- Glossary
- FAQs
- Release Notes
- Maintenance Notification
- [2024-09-15] TiDB Cloud Console Maintenance Notification
- [2024-04-18] TiDB Cloud Data Migration (DM) Feature Maintenance Notification
- [2024-04-16] TiDB Cloud Monitoring Features Maintenance Notification
- [2024-04-11] TiDB Cloud Data Migration (DM) Feature Maintenance Notification
- [2024-04-09] TiDB Cloud Monitoring Features Maintenance Notification
- [2023-11-14] TiDB Dedicated Scale Feature Maintenance Notification
- [2023-09-26] TiDB Cloud Console Maintenance Notification
- [2023-08-31] TiDB Cloud Console Maintenance Notification